Subject: Recalled Voltbridge chargers — pallet ready for return

Team,

The pallet of recalled Voltbridge V2 chargers is wrapped and staged in Bay 4, labelled RETURN ONLY. Do not mix it with outbound retail stock. The courier from Larkspan Freight is booked for Thursday morning and will bring their own manifest. Count the cartons together before anything leaves the dock. The confidential hand-over instruction for the driver is as follows:

drop instructions, hafop-yahig: the gorix kasok courier leaves the drueth druiel fenwyn ledger at gate 7036 under passcode 893133

☐ Key ceremony, step 7 — Seal the Wrenfield relevance-tuning archive. The search relevance tuning notes (boost weights, synonym maps, judgment lists) are encrypted and stored in the Oakenshaw vault. Two custodians must witness the sealing. Future maintainers: to reopen the archive after the ceremony, use the recovery passphrase recorded below.

vault phrase of tawig-taduf = zorath-oliwyn

Subject: Insurance Renewal — Briefing for Incoming Director

Dear colleagues,

Ahead of the handover, a summary of the Harwicke Group policy renewal: our property and liability cover expires at quarter-end, and the broker has indicated a premium increase of roughly twelve percent, driven by last year's claim at the Dunmere facility. I recommend we accept the revised terms while negotiating a higher deductible. The strategic considerations are noted below.

board note of fahif-yahog: Gross margin on Wenath came in at 10 percent against a plan of 5 percent. Only 3 of the 100 pilot accounts renewed Wenath, so a churn review is set for July 15.

We are ending the arrangement with Dorvane Haulage and moving all regional distribution to Kestrel Line Freight effective next quarter. Review of the last two quarters shows Dorvane's per-pallet costs rose 11% while on-time delivery fell below contract thresholds. Kestrel's terms lock rates for 24 months. Branch managers should expect minor schedule disruption during the four-week cutover; budget variances must be flagged weekly to the finance desk. The confidential planning note below explains the broader rationale for this shift.

board note of kagep-yahig: Only 9 of the 120 pilot accounts renewed Quenix, so a churn review is set for April 1.